Cherry Floor Refinishing in Alpharetta, GA
Cherry Floor Refinishing services involve restoring and renewing existing hardwood floors to enhance their appearance and durability. This process typically includes sanding away surface imperfections, removing old finishes, and applying new coatings to achieve a smooth, polished look. Projects often cover areas such as living rooms, dining rooms, hallways, and other spaces with hardwood flooring that has become scratched, stained, or worn over time. Property owners usually seek refinishing to improve the aesthetic appeal of their floors or to prepare a home for sale, ensuring a fresh and updated look.
Before requesting Cherry Floor Refinishing, property owners should consider the current condition of their floors, including the type of wood, the extent of damage or wear, and any existing finishes. It’s important to understand the scope of work needed, such as whether repairs or replacement are necessary prior to refinishing. Clarifying the desired finish, whether matte, semi-gloss, or high-gloss, can also help ensure the results meet expectations. Proper preparation and communication about the existing flooring conditions can contribute to a successful refinishing project.

Cherry Floor Refinishing Questions
What types of wood floors can be refinished? Cherry floor refinishing services can restore a variety of wood floors, including oak, maple, and hickory, to a fresh, smooth finish.
How often should a wood floor be refinished? Typically, hardwood floors can be refinished every 7-10 years, depending on wear and tear, to maintain their appearance.
What finishes are available for refinished floors? A range of finishes, such as matte, semi-gloss, or high-gloss, can be applied to match the desired look and durability needs.
Are repairs necessary before refinishing? Any deep scratches, gouges, or damaged boards should be repaired prior to refinishing to ensure a uniform surface.
